RECOMMENDATION:
Staff recommends the City of Culver City approve an agreement with NBS Inc. ("NBS") for special tax administration services related to West Washington Assessment Districts Nos. 1, 2 and 3 for a term up to five years in an aggregate amount not to exceed $78,000.
BACKGROUND
In December 2007, the former Culver City Redevelopment Agency approved an Area Improvement Plan (AIP) Program that included a phased installation of streetscape medians along West Washington Blvd. Phase I is between Wade Street and Beethoven Street, Phase II is between Boise Avenue and Centinela Avenue, Phase III is comprised of existing medians at Zanja Street and Washington Boulevard (only replanting and lighting enhancements) and Phase IV, slated for construction in the fall 2022, is between Beethoven Street and Glencoe Avenue. The improvements were (and will be) constructed by the City with on-going maintenance for the new improvements funded by adjacent property owners via the collection of an annual assessment (Assessment).
